When you are pregnant, the physical changes that come with the pregnancy can cause you a certain amount of distress at first. However, as your pregnancy progresses, you begin to love the fact that you are soon to be a proud mother, oblivious to the way you looked during your pregnancy. When you are 12 weeks pregnant, belly bulge is the one thing that keeps your mind occupied. You keep wondering whether the weight gain that comes with the pregnancy has made you look heavy, and whether the belly that your pregnancy has given you, has made you look unattractive.
